Step Into AI: From Awareness to Action
This introductory session supports Indigenous Nations and HR leaders in understanding the risks, opportunities, and responsibilities that come with AI adoption. Participants explore the fundamentals of tools like ChatGPT, with a focus on how AI can support policy development, recruitment, communication, and organizational efficiency. The session includes real-world examples, guided demonstrations, and frameworks for evaluating AI tools in line with Nation values, data sovereignty, and ethical governance. Designed to spark critical thinking and cultural alignment, this session helps leaders begin shaping AI strategies that are transparent, human-led, and rooted in community priorities

The SISU Within: A Journey of Strength, Self, and Rediscovering My Magic through Teaching and AI
In this deeply personal keynote, Jennifer Hufnagel shares her journey through professional burnout, reinvention, and rediscovery, guided by the unexpected spark of generative AI. Framed by the Finnish concept of sisu, she reflects on the highs of a high-growth tech career, the quiet devastation of hitting rock bottom, and the courage it takes to rebuild with intention. Audiences are invited to consider their own relationship to resilience, career identity, and emerging technology. More than a talk on AI, this is a story about finding your footing in uncertain times, reclaiming your magic, and embracing change with both vulnerability and strength.
